Sister Bear Designs, which was created in 2013, is now located in Thunder Bay's Goods and Co. Market
Amid one of the most difficult times of Kathleen Sawdo’s life, when she lodged a human rights complaint about her identity as an Indigenous person against the police services out in Alberta, where she lived at the time, her father would tell her to come back home to what you know.Sawdo went back to her hometown — Thunder Bay — she picked up the beads, and the needle, and started beading.
Sawdo started creating these unique Indigenous handmade items, including beaded jewellery and other traditional handmade Indigenous wearable art. The creations honour the family’s connection to the land. Sawdo said growing up, the bear clan sisters learned a lot from her elders — how to be in the bush, how to forage and harvest, how to fish.
“If you don't see us you forget about us,” she said. “And sometimes they forget we matter if they don't see us, and sometimes they forget how much we contribute to the city if we're not in those spaces where you don't typically see Indigenous people.” “I didn't realize something so simple in my mind, and listening to the words of my dad, go back to what you know, would have such a huge impact on my family.”
